Sherwood Aviation is a recognized leader in the Aerospace and Defense Industry, offering component Repair & Overhaul, Sales & OEM Distribution, Engineering & Manufacturing services, and Training& Technical Support to customers world‐wide is looking for a Sales Account Manager to join our team.
The Sales Account Manager – Aviation is responsible for developing, maintaining, and growing relationships with customers within the aviation and aerospace industry. This position serves as a primary point of contact for assigned accounts and works closely with customers and internal departments to ensure customer requirements are understood, communicated, and successfully fulfilled.
The Sales Account Manager manages customer inquiries, quotations, purchase orders, pricing, delivery expectations, and account performance while identifying opportunities to increase sales and strengthen long-term customer relationships.
Key Responsibilities
Requirements
- Manage and develop relationships with assigned aviation and aerospace customers.
- Serve as the primary point of contact for customer inquiries, quotations, order status, delivery schedules, pricing, and general account requirements.
- Develop a strong understanding of customers' businesses, products, programs, purchasing requirements, and future needs.
- Identify opportunities to grow existing accounts and develop new business within the aviation and aerospace market.
- Prepare and coordinate quotations, pricing proposals, and responses to customer Requests for Quote (RFQs).
- Review customer purchase orders and requirements to ensure pricing, quantities, delivery dates, and commercial terms align with approved quotations and company capabilities.
- Coordinate with Operations, Purchasing, Engineering, Quality, Production, Shipping, Finance, and other departments to support customer requirements.
- Monitor open orders and proactively communicate potential delays, shortages, or other issues affecting customer commitments.
- Maintain regular communication with customers regarding order status, production schedules, deliveries, and other account-related matters.
- Negotiate pricing, delivery expectations, and commercial terms within established company guidelines and approval authority.
- Support resolution of returns, quality concerns, delivery issues, and other customer service matters.
- Maintain accurate customer, opportunity, quotation, and sales activity information within the company's CRM, ERP, or other business systems.
- Develop and maintain knowledge of company products, capabilities, manufacturing processes, and services.
- Participate in customer meetings, business reviews, trade shows, conferences, and industry events as required.
- Support annual sales planning, budgeting, and account-growth initiatives.
- Maintain professional and ethical business relationships with customers and suppliers.
- Perform other duties and special projects as assigned.
